Northboat Story
Founded in July 13, 2015 by Jean-François Pitot and Romain Desvaux, Northern Boatworks, now known as Northboat, draws its inspiration from a shared passion for boating.
Initially, the project was to design a boat for personal use, but in response to a growing demand, Northboat was officially established.
The company's first steps took place in Solitude, in a modest 20m2 space, marked by the creation of the Bay Master 185.
In the early days, the team consisted of three members, including Afzal, the current production manager, who still holds this position today who has more than 20 years expertise in this field.
Northboat began its journey with the Bay Master 185 models, specifically designed for shallow waters, in particular St Brandon, thanks to an innovative tunnel.
At the same time, the Bay Master 135 was launched.
The company's core values emerged from an initial passion for boating and the sea, with the original vision of establishing itself in the local Mauritian naval industry.
Today, this vision extends to the international market, with an established presence in the Indian Ocean and neighbouring islands such as Reunion and the Seychelles.
Northboat aims to offer a global service in the nautical field, covering: travel, rental, maintenance and after-sales service.
​
A core value of the company is the promotion of local manpower, through investment in training to ensure a more secure future.
The aim is to reinforce Mauritian know-how in naval production, thus guaranteeing long-term expertise in this field in Mauritius.
